Why Topical Maps Are Essential for SEO in 2026
Google's algorithms have evolved far beyond simple keyword matching. In 2026, the search engine rewards websites that demonstrate comprehensive topical expertise — what SEOs call "topical authority." A topical map is a structured plan that identifies every subtopic, question, and entity within your niche, then maps them to individual pieces of content that interlink strategically.
Without a topical map, content teams often produce scattered articles that compete with each other (keyword cannibalization) or leave critical subtopics uncovered (topical gaps). The result is wasted budget, inconsistent rankings, and an inability to compete with sites that have built genuine authority through systematic coverage.

2. Surfer AI
Good for on-page optimization scores
Surfer AI is best known for its content editor that provides real-time optimization scores based on top-ranking pages. While it excels at on-page SEO guidance, it lacks a native topical map feature, meaning you need a separate tool for content planning. Surfer AI generates articles directly within its editor, but the output often requires manual editing to reach publication quality. At $89/month for the basic plan, it is significantly more expensive per article than pay-per-use alternatives. Best suited for teams that already have a content strategy and need optimization scoring.
3. Frase
Affordable content brief generation
Frase is an affordable option for content brief generation and question research. It scrapes top SERPs to identify headings, questions, and topics to cover. However, its AI writing capabilities are limited compared to dedicated AI writers — the generated content often needs substantial rewriting. Frase lacks bulk generation, GSC integration, and auto-publishing. At $15/month for the basic plan, it is a good entry point for solo bloggers who primarily need research assistance rather than end-to-end content production.
4. MarketMuse
Enterprise content planning
MarketMuse is an enterprise-grade content planning platform that uses its own topic modeling technology to identify content gaps and prioritize topics by difficulty and value. Its topical mapping is strong, but the tool does not generate publication-ready content — it produces briefs that your writers or AI tools then execute. Pricing starts at $149/month with significant limitations on the lower tiers. Best for large organizations with dedicated content teams and budgets to match.
5. Writesonic
General-purpose AI writing
Writesonic offers a broad suite of AI writing features including blog posts, ads, and social media copy. While it supports bulk generation and WordPress publishing, it lacks SERP analysis and topical mapping — meaning the content it produces is not optimized for specific search queries. The output quality varies, and SEO-focused teams often find they need additional optimization tools on top of Writesonic. Affordable for general-purpose writing but not a standalone SEO content solution.
6. Scalenut
Keyword clustering with content generation
Scalenut combines keyword clustering with AI content generation, making it a decent mid-range option. Its Cruise Mode walks you through research, outline, and writing in a guided workflow. However, it lacks GSC integration, cannot auto-publish, and its bulk capabilities are limited. The topical clustering feature is useful but less granular than a dedicated topical map tool. At $39/month, it offers reasonable value for small teams that want an all-in-one approach without enterprise pricing.
